SESSION SUMMARY: When was the last time you paused to determine how well you are doing as a decision-maker? The typical adult makes hundreds of decisions each day, many of which could be described as medium or high-stakes situations. Learning more about how people interpret, frame, and act on information when time is limited can raise the likelihood of good outcomes.
In this session, we explore why experienced professionals make avoidable mistakes and examine the factors that separate excellent decision-makers from others. Blending behavioral insights with practical tools, this session challenges common assumptions about analysis, intuition, and “best practices.”
Participants will leave with clearer decision discipline, simple frameworks they can use immediately, and practical ways to improve decision quality—individually and in groups—when the stakes are high and certainty is low.
LEARNING OBJECTIVES:
Use simple decision frameworks to improve clarity, speed, and confidence in ambiguous, high-stakes situations.
Recognize subtle decision traps that affect experienced professionals and apply techniques to reduce their impact.
Improve group decision quality, including how to surface assumptions, invite challenges, and find alignment.
